Доброго времени, нужно написать чекер на c++
Создание WPF контрола видео-плеера
Разместите заказ на фриланс-бирже и предложения поступят уже через несколько минут.
Необходимо создать контрол видео-плеера со следушими характеристиками:
1. Среда выполнения WPF .NET Framework 3.5
2. Функция записи rtsp потока (Н.264+) в файл (путь к файлу задаётся).
2.1. Объём при записи видеоинформации не более 2000 МБ в час.
2.2. Частота кадров при записи требуется не менее 15 к/с.
2.3. В составе записи должен присутствовать тайм-код (текущая дата и время
записи) и хронометраж (отсчёт продолжительности записи). Формат и
расположение тайм-кода и хронометража должны задаваться в настройках
контрола.
2.4. Требование к видео-файлу один из форматов: avi, mp4, m4v, mkv. Формат кодирования – H.264/H.264+.
3. Функция приостановки записи (пауза) потока в файл.
4. Функция продолжения записи (выход из паузы) в тот же файл, в которой писалось до перехода в паузу.
5. Функция отображения в контроле записываемого потока и звука.
6. Функция отображение эквалайзера (мощности звука) внизу контрола с
бегунком, регулирующим усиления (уменьшения) громкости звукового потока.
Предел усиления – 400%.
7. Наличие функции отключить звук – отключает запись звука.
8. Помимо записи звука в файл с видео необходимо ещё записывать аудио поток в отдельный файл.
Аудиофайл должен быть одного из форматов: wav, mp3, m4a, wma.
Оцифровка звука на каждом аудиоканале с разрядностью не менее 16 бит с частотой
оцифровки не ниже 22 050 Гц, при этом максимальный объём при записи
аудиоинформации должна быть не более 7,3 МБ в час (при задействованной
функции сжатия).
9. Функция воспроизведения видео и аудио из созданных ранее файлов.
9.1. функция перемотки на указанное время
9.2 Функция увеличения скорости воспроизведения видео и аудио.
9.3. Функция уменьшения скорости воспроизведения видео и аудио.
9.4. Регулятор уровня громкости записи с возможностью усиления.
9.5. Прогресс бар воспроизведения видео/ауодио должен иметь возможность
отображать временные метки и давать возможность щелчком мышки по ним
переходить (перематывать видео/аудио файл).
10. Должны использоваться только OpenSource библиотеки.
11. Наличие комментариев всех публичных функций и свойств.
12. В качестве примера работы контрола создать тестовое WPF приложение.
Заявки фрилансеров
Похожие заказы
- Системное программирование2 заявкиЗакрыт8 лет назад
- $15
Нужен cкрипт, который должен запускаться каждый день в определенное время и проделывать одну и ту же операцию. Нужно в базе данных PostgreSQL, сканировать все таблицы с названиями *_12 (например, sumki_12, bakal_12...), таблицы bakal_16 не трогать. В ...
Системное программирование7 заявокЗакрыт8 лет назад Нужно разработать программу, которая в автоматическом режиме лайкает аватарки или фото людей строго по заданному возрасту, стране и городу.
Системное программирование8 заявокЗакрыт8 лет назадНужно создать простой софтофон (SIP) (десктопный, т.е. для компьютера Windows) В софтофоне чтобы моно было указать: логин, пароль, SIP сервер. В софтофоне будут несколько полей: > «Клиент» (текстовое поле) ...
Системное программирование1 заявкаЗакрыт8 лет назадНеобходимо написать программу для Ацпи + атмеловский контроллер + память(память не программируется в этом варианте ) ( Название и марке может варироватся) Всё устройство должно принимать сигнал с колебательного элемента,переобразововать,шифровать и ...
Системное программирование1 заявкаЗакрыт8 лет назад- $10
Добрый день. Необходимо написать Скрипт (обработку) для преобразования XML файла из одного вида в другой. ТЗ в приложении.
Системное программирование1 заявкаЗакрыт8 лет назад Добрый день всем! Использую serverdale.ru Проблема в том что мне необходимо создать другой сервер и перенести туда данные с VDS, поддержка предлагает работать по сильно завышенному тарифу, хотя работы ...
Системное программирование5 заявокЗакрыт8 лет назадДисциплина - Программирование тема работы - Программа на языке C++ Шрифт - 14 pt Оригинальность работы - 60% Крайний срок сдачи работы - 08.11.2016 Дополнительная информация - Речь идёт о ...
Системное программирование6 заявокЗакрыт8 лет назадНужно сделать сборку браузера chromium под Windows Браузер заменяет google chrome, если такой установлен в системе, используя профиль пользователя от него. Подробное задание в skype
Системное программирование2 заявкиЗакрыт8 лет назад- $5
автоматизировать действия в windows, тривиальная задача
Системное программирование10 заявокЗакрыт8 лет назад